| import os
 | |
| import os.path
 | |
| import re
 | |
| import sys
 | |
| import subprocess
 | |
| import shutil
 | |
| import glob
 | |
| import grp
 | |
| from qubes.qubes import QubesVmCollection
 | |
| 
 | |
| updates_dir = "/var/lib/qubes/updates"
 | |
| updates_rpm_dir = updates_dir + "/rpm"
 | |
| updates_repodata_dir = updates_dir + "/repodata"
 | |
| 
 | |
| package_regex = re.compile(r"^[ab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0123456789._+-]{1,128}.rpm$")
 | |
| gpg_ok_regex = re.compile(r"pgp md5 OK$")
 | |
| 
 | |
| def dom0updates_fatal(msg):
 | |
|     print >> sys.stderr, msg
 | |
|     shutil.rmtree(updates_rpm_dir)
 | |
|     exit(1)
 | |
| 
 | |
| def handle_dom0updates(updatevm):
 | |
|     source=os.getenv("QREXEC_REMOTE_DOMAIN")
 | |
|     if source != updatevm.name:
 | |
|         print >> sys.stderr, 'Domain ' + source + ' not allowed to send dom0 updates'
 | |
|         exit(1)
 | |
|     # Clean old packages
 | |
|     if os.path.exists(updates_rpm_dir):
 | |
|         shutil.rmtree(updates_rpm_dir)
 | |
|     if os.path.exists(updates_repodata_dir):
 | |
|         shutil.rmtree(updates_repodata_dir)
 | |
|     qubes_gid = grp.getgrnam('qubes').gr_gid
 | |
|     os.mkdir(updates_rpm_dir)
 | |
|     os.chown(updates_rpm_dir, -1, qubes_gid)
 | |
|     os.chmod(updates_rpm_dir, 0775)
 | |
|     subprocess.check_call(["/usr/lib/qubes/qfile-dom0-unpacker", str(os.getuid()), updates_rpm_dir])
 | |
|     # Verify received files
 | |
|     for f in os.listdir(updates_rpm_dir):
 | |
|         full_path = updates_rpm_dir + "/" + f
 | |
|         if package_regex.match(f):
 | |
|             if os.path.islink(full_path) or not os.path.isfile(full_path):
 | |
|                 dom0updates_fatal('Domain ' + source + ' sent not regular file')
 | |
|             p = subprocess.Popen (["/bin/rpm", "-K", full_path],
 | |
|                     st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
 | |
|             output = p.communicate()[0]
 | |
|             if p.returncode != 0:
 | |
|                 dom0updates_fatal('Error while verifing %s signature: %s' % (f, output))
 | |
|             if not gpg_ok_regex.search(output.strip()):
 | |
|                 dom0updates_fatal('Domain ' + source + ' sent not signed rpm: ' + f)
 | |
|         else:
 | |
|             dom0updates_fatal('Domain ' + source + ' sent unexpected file: ' + f)
 | |
|     # After updates received - create repo metadata
 | |
|     subprocess.check_call(["/usr/bin/createrepo", "-q", updates_dir])
 | |
|     os.chown(updates_repodata_dir, -1, qubes_gid)
 | |
|     os.chmod(updates_repodata_dir, 0775)
 | |
|     # Clean old cache
 | |
|     subprocess.call(["sudo", "/usr/bin/yum", "-q", "clean", "all"], stdout=sys.stderr)
 | |
|     # This will fail because of "smart" detection of no-network, but it will invalidate the cache
 | |
|     try:
 | |
|         null = open('/dev/null','w')
 | |
|         subprocess.call(["/usr/bin/pkcon", "refresh"], stdout=null)
 | |
|         null.close()
 | |
|     except:
 | |
|         pass
 | |
|     exit(0)
 | |
| 
 | |
| def main():
 | |
| 
 | |
|     qvm_collection = QubesVmCollection()
 | |
|     qvm_collection.lock_db_for_reading()
 | |
|     qvm_collection.load()
 | |
|     qvm_collection.unlock_db()
 | |
|     
 | |
|     updatevm = qvm_collection.get_updatevm_vm()
 | |
|     handle_dom0updates(updatevm)
 | |
| 
 | |
| main()
